- The distance between Bucyrus, Oh, Usa and Cedars, Bsharri, Lebanon is approximately 9,598 km or 5,964 mi.
- To reach Bucyrus, Oh in this distance one would set out from Cedars, Bsharri bearing 318.5°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Bucyrus, Oh bearing 226.4° or SW .
- Bucyrus, Oh has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Cedars, Bsharri has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
- Both are in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 0.3 °C (0.5°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.5 °C (17.1°F) more in Bucyrus, Oh.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 40.4 mm (1.6 in) more which is equivalent to 40.4 l/m² (0.99 US gal/ft²) or 404,000 l/ha (43,190 US gal/ac) more.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6.5° lower in Bucyrus, Oh than in Cedars, Bsharri.
